Information vs Advice – Understanding the Difference
Health Information
Health information is widely available through websites, apps, videos and automated programmes. It helps people understand general topics such as:
-
How certain treatments work
-
Common side effects
-
Typical lifestyle guidance
-
General health education
Information is useful for building awareness, but it is designed to apply broadly. It cannot fully reflect your individual medical history, examination findings or personal goals.
Personalised Clinical Advice
Advice is tailored to the individual. It is based on professional assessment and clinical judgement.
At Bramley Pharmacy, consultations focus on understanding:
-
Your symptoms and health concerns
-
Previous treatments and outcomes
-
Blood test results where appropriate
-
Lifestyle factors and long-term wellbeing
This allows recommendations to be personalised and adjusted over time where necessary.
Why Face-to-Face Pharmacy Services May Differ in Cost
Patients sometimes notice that in-person services can be more expensive than online options. The reason often relates to how care is delivered.
Online providers frequently rely on automated pathways and standardised processes. These can be appropriate for certain situations, but they may not offer the same level of ongoing clinical interaction.
Our pharmacist-led clinics prioritise:
-
Individual consultations
-
Clinical assessment and monitoring
-
Follow-up reviews when needed
-
Safe prescribing decisions based on suitability
The aim is not simply access to treatment, but support that encourages safe and sustainable health outcomes. Every patient is assessed individually, and treatment is only offered when appropriate.
